什么是积压库存?

含义

积压库存(Overstock)指的是转售商或收藏家购买的、数量超过即时市场需求的商品。主流的对应词是“剩余库存”(surplus inventory)。在收藏品领域,这通常意味着大量相同或相似的物品,通常是从清算商、清仓店或正在清理多余仓库货物的分销商那里获得的。它与“批量购买”(bulk buy,指对数量进行议价折扣)不同;积压库存意味着卖家有必须处理的剩余货品,通常是以固定的、折扣的批发价格出售。

对价格的影响

积压库存从根本上降低了单位的采购成本。其转售价值是物品的固有吸引力与批次成本之间的函数关系。一个需求量大、当前热门的积压库存物品,其加价幅度可能达到批发成本的 2 倍到 3 倍。相反,滞销或过时的积压库存,如果需要清仓,可能只能实现 0.5 倍的加价,甚至达到收支平衡。例如,以每件 5 美元(总计 500 美元)的价格购买 100 张当前流行的中端黑胶唱片,理论上可以以每件 15 美元的价格出售,实现 1000 美元的总收入。

如何识别

主要的判断依据是卖家的描述:“X 件套”(Lot of X)、“仓库清仓”(Warehouse Clearance)或“多余库存”(Excess Inventory)。要留意多个单位上是否存在批次编号或相同的包装。在收藏品中,积压库存通常表现为来自特定、不太受欢迎的 SKU(库存单位)或特定生产批次,而这些是主要零售商订购过多的。务必索要显示包装数量或盒子背面库存贴纸的照片,该贴纸通常会详细说明批次大小。对于高度独特、低销量的物品,要警惕“积压库存”的说法;那通常只是一个描述不佳的单个单位。

明智采购

只有当物品具有高且持续的市场需求,并且采购成本远低于既定的零售价值时,为积压库存支付溢价才是合理的。这种策略最适用于快速周转、消耗性或趋势驱动的商品(例如,季节性服装、热门游戏配件)。它不适用于小众、高度专业化或快速过时的物品。一个公平的交易标准是批发成本占单位预估零售价值的 30% 或更低。

明智销售

在挂牌销售积压库存时,透明度是关键。将物品标记为“仓库积压库存”(Warehouse Overstock)或“批次清仓”(Lot Clearance)可以管理买家对品相一致性或轻微包装瑕疵的期望。这种诚实可以避免负面评价。挂牌中最有效的一点是清晰地展示正在出售的物品的*数量*的照片,或者明确注明“作为批量库存出售”(Sold as part of a bulk lot)。这能验证折扣结构,并吸引那些专门寻找库存数量的买家。
